ا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

الردود الموصى بها

قام بنشر (معدل)

السلام عليكم 

ارجو منكم مساعدتي بتعديل الكود في النموذج المرفق
المطلوب عند الضغط على زر الطباعة في شيت (a1) يعمل الكود على طباعة شيت (s1) بالكامل والبالغة عدد صفحاتها 6 صفحات

نموذج.xlsx

تم تعديل بواسطه ميسون الدايني
  • تمت الإجابة
قام بنشر (معدل)

وعليكم السلام ورحمة الله وبركاته

ملفك لا بحتوى على اي كود

تم عمل كود لطلبك والكود مرن يطبع الى اخر صف قيه بيانات

Sub PrPAGES()
    Dim printWS As Worksheet
    Dim lastRow As Long
    Dim printRange As Range

    Set printWS = ThisWorkbook.Sheets("S1")
    
    lastRow = printWS.Cells(printWS.Rows.Count, "A").End(xlUp).Row

    Set printRange = printWS.Range("A1:C" & lastRow)
    
    printWS.PageSetup.PrintArea = printRange.Address
    
    printWS.PrintOut
End Sub

1نموذج.xlsb

 

تم تعديل بواسطه عبدالله بشير عبدالله
  • Like 5

انشئ حساب جديد او قم بتسجيل دخولك لتتمكن من اضافه تعليق جديد

يجب ان تكون عضوا لدينا لتتمكن من التعليق

انشئ حساب جديد

سجل حسابك الجديد لدينا في الموقع بمنتهي السهوله .

سجل حساب جديد

تسجيل دخول

هل تمتلك حساب بالفعل ؟ سجل دخولك من هنا.

س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information